Explosion in France as football friendly goes on




PARIS — On a night of terrifying violence in Paris with two explosions going off outside the stadium, France beat Germany 2-0 Friday in a game overshadowed by the events around the city.


The explosions could be heard inside the Stade de France as they went off nearby in the first half.

A shoot out followed after the explosions and according to euronews via french police, 42 people have been killed in shootings and explosions around Paris, but the match was not halted.

Fans have decided to remaine inside the stadium after the final whistle, with several going onto the pitch as news of the violence spread.

According to French police, at least 100  hostages are being kept inside a theatre

Olivier Giroud and substitute Andre-Pierre Gignac scored a goal each in the friendly.
